Mirum Pharmaceuticals, a biopharmaceutical company focused on rare diseases, is seeking a Therapeutic Account Manager (TAM) for its Liver portfolio. This role is responsible for delivering strong business performance and meaningful patient impact across an assigned territory, with a focus on rare cholestatic liver diseases. The TAM develops deep clinical and account expertise in Mirum's Liver portfolio and identifies high-opportunity customers, accounts, and referral networks. You will execute customized account plans that advance disease awareness, appropriate patient identification, treatment consideration, initiation, and persistence in accordance with approved indications and promotional practices. Key responsibilities include developing and executing focused territory business plans aligned with national, zone, and regional priorities; using performance data and market intelligence to identify opportunities and adjust strategy; maintaining accurate customer records and forecasts; identifying and prioritizing high-opportunity accounts across pediatric and adult hepatology and gastroenterology; creating customized account plans reflecting local patient journeys and clinical decision-making; building trusted relationships with physicians, advanced practice providers, nurses, pharmacists, and care team members; mapping influence and decision-making within complex accounts; and coordinating compliant account actions across field partners. You will develop and maintain deep knowledge of rare cholestatic liver disease, diagnostic pathways, mechanisms of action, clinical data, product profiles, approved uses, safety information, patient support pathways, and access/reimbursement dynamics. You will communicate complex scientific information clearly and credibly, tailored to each healthcare professional's knowledge and priorities. You will engage as a clinically credible peer, asking insightful questions, listening actively, and connecting relevant evidence to customer practices. The ideal candidate is not a transactional seller but a clinically credible, insight-led partner who engages healthcare professionals as a peer, asks thoughtful questions, constructively challenges clinical inertia, and influences change across complex accounts. You will demonstrate curiosity, high emotional intelligence, resilience, ownership, and consistent follow-through while working closely with the Regional Business Director and cross-functional partners.
